Betty Ann Lyle Johansen

Jul 5, 2023

April 25, 1938 — June 30, 2023

Betty Ann Lyle Johansen, born April 25, 1938 in Ogden, Utah, passed away June 30, 2023 at her home in South Ogden, Utah surrounded by family. Betty was the daughter of John Carlton Lyle and Betty McBride and graduated from Ogden High School with the class of 1956. She married Jerry George Johansen on October 14, 1955 in Ogden, Utah. The marriage was later solemnized in the Logan Temple on May 11, 1964. Betty spent the majority of her life in the Ogden area with the last 66 years at her residence in South Ogden.

Betty was always busy and worked to contribute to the family income by babysitting, helping her husband at Inkley’s, scooping ice-cream at Farr’s, and helping children safely cross the street on 40th and Madison as a crossing guard. She told some great stories about the cars that wouldn’t slow down for the children.

Betty was a member of the DUP (Daughters of Utah Pioneers) and served in the leadership of that organization. She was a faithful member of The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ints and served in numerous positions including two stints as Relief Society President in the South Ogden 38th and now 3rd Ward. Betty especially enjoyed serving as an Ogden Temple worker and cherished those associations and service to others.

Betty and Jerry served the community through the Jaycees and Kiwanis Clubs. Mom was an avid traveler and loved hiking area mountains. She traveled throughout much of the United States. She also enjoyed cruises to New Zealand and Alaska, a Safari to Africa, and a trip to Belize. She would have liked to travel more.

Betty is survived by her four children, Jerry Bradley (Tamara) Johansen; Linda Kay (Thomas) Tidwell; Julie Ann (Gary) Turner; Vickie Lynne (Ty) Coniglio; a daughter-in-law, Sara Denise Johansen; 14 grandchildren; 26 great-grandchildren; 5 great-great-grandchildren; sister, Charlene Lyle Bassett; as well as numerous nieces, nephews, and other extended family members. She was preceded in death by her husband; and her youngest son, Peter Lyle Johansen; parents; and her younger brother, David Carlton Lyle.
